A tight and unmarked copy-" Whether you're old, young, new to the sport, or an experienced marathoner, this guide will change how you run and the results you achieve! Any runner can tell you that the sport isn't just about churning out miles a day in and day out. Runners have a passion, dedication, and desire to go faster, longer, and further. Now, "The Art of Running Faster" provides you with a new approach to running, achieving your goals, and setting your personal best. "The Art of Running Faster" challenges the stereotypes, removes the doubts, and erases the self-imposed limitations by prescribing not only what to do but also how to do it. Inside, you will learn how to overcome the obstacles that prevent you from running faster, more comfortably, and with greater focus. Customize your training program to emphasize the development of speed, strength, and stamina to ensure you reach that next level of performance and blow past the competition."
